An opportunity in op-notes
Abstract:
Operative notes in surgical practice are a vital source of information and communication between healthcare professionals as well as being a legal document. Errors and omissions can have serious effects on patient care and lead to confusion. We audited our compliance within trauma and orthopaedics at a busy district general hospital in South East England with the standard set by the Royal College of Surgeons (England) before and after the introduction of an operation note template. We achieved significant improvements in compliance across almost all of the standard's domains and recommend widespread implementation of similar templates nationally.
